Bulgaria’s 2009 Eurovision song contest representative Krasimir Avramov was arrested by mistake early Thursday as part of the special police operation code-named "The Untouchable”.

Avramov aka the Man-voice, was arrested early Thursday when police raided his home, forced him to lie on the ground, handcuffed him and also covered his head. After they realized their mistake the police apologized to the singer and left.

According to Avramov, the police probably had been provided the wrong information and had mistaken the address.

He added that “I heard doors breaking and thought it must be a burglary. Then I saw the policemen and they rushed to get me down on to the floor. I said I was Krasimir Avramov and things soon became calm. The commented – this is the singer and then apologized and left.”

Ten people were arrested in the operation targeting suspected members of a group for money laundering and tax crimes, which have incurred huge losses to the state, the Interior Minister Tsvetan Tsvetanov announced.
